			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The <span class="style28"><strong><a class="wpGallery" title="The Breadou dot Com" href="http://www.thebreadou.com/" target="_blank">Breadou</a></strong></span> is made from flexible polyurethane foam (FPF). Polyurethane is the result of the chemistry of two primary materials used to make polyurethane products &#8211; methylene diphenyl diisocyanate (MDI) and toluene diisocyanate (TDI). MDI and TDI are known to be stable in the environment. When disposed, they have not shown any adverse impact on municipal waste handling processes, landfills or incineration.</p>
